
Chivas USA
Chivas USA was a professional soccer team based in Los Angeles, part of Major League Soccer (MLS), and affiliated with the Mexican club Chivas Guadalajara. Founded in 2004, it aimed to promote Hispanic and Mexican-American soccer fans. The team struggled with consistent performance and fan support, and despite efforts to grow its presence, it faced financial challenges. In 2014, MLS decided to shut down Chivas USA due to these issues. The franchise was then replaced by LA Galaxy II, serving as a developmental team for the sport. Overall, Chivas USA was an important chapter in U.S. soccer history, highlighting regional and cultural connections.
